Select Brand:

Show All


£170.47

Dispatch on next business day

£62.96

Dispatch on next business day

£12.32

Dispatch on next business day

£73.65

Dispatch on next business day

£25.19

Dispatch on next business day

£27.79

Dispatch on next business day

£26.70

Dispatch on next business day

£27.97

Dispatch on next business day

£24.73

Dispatch on next business day

£4.53

Dispatch on next business day

£86.85

Dispatch on next business day

£25.47

Dispatch on next business day